Hello mommies! As promise on my social medias, here is a simple DIY Tutorial on making a baby's headband. I actually did this as part of my daughter's birthday preparation.
Before we begin, here are the materials needed to create your baby girl's headband.
- Felt Papers
- Scissors
- marker
- Glue stick
- Glue gun
- Elastic bands
Gather all your materials and start it by tracing a round object on a felt paper sheet.
Cut the traced felt paper using a scissor.
Right after cutting it fold it length and crosswise to determine the center and mark it using a marker.
Draw a spiral pattern starting at the center.
Cut the traced mark using your scissors.
Then roll it to create a flower formed rose.
Now that you have successfully made a flower out of a felt paper, you can now attach it on the elastic using the glue gun. I wasn't able to take a photo of the last step because my baby wokes up. But it's up to you on how many or what design you would love to create. You can also look around and find an inspiration.
